Output db6684851635d08f7c05ddce200f3fdda3dd575cf06cf24563c181201aa70c0e:0

value
109258578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 584696e2a965d5d3ddabf2201d850f04f4f8106e OP_EQUAL
address
MFwvFwxyDbLnDrkcDmHzXKUmqcKLVXgPAd
transaction
db6684851635d08f7c05ddce200f3fdda3dd575cf06cf24563c181201aa70c0e
spent
true